管理自动构建

Note

自动构建需要 Docker Pro、Team 或 Business 订阅。

取消或重试构建

当构建处于排队或运行状态时,其构建报告链接旁边会显示一个取消图标,该图标出现在常规选项卡和构建选项卡上。您也可以在构建报告页面上,或从构建的时间线选项卡的日志显示中选择取消

显示取消图标的构建列表

检查您的活跃构建

仓库的构建摘要既显示在仓库的常规选项卡上,也显示在构建选项卡上。构建选项卡还显示了构建队列时间和时长的彩色编码条形图。两种视图都会显示仓库任何标签的待处理、进行中、成功和失败的构建。

活跃构建

从任一位置,您可以选择一个构建作业以查看其构建报告。构建报告显示有关构建作业的信息,包括源仓库和分支或标签、构建日志、构建时长、创建时间和位置,以及执行构建的用户账户。

Note

现在,当您刷新构建页面时,可以每 30 秒查看一次构建进度。借助进行中的构建日志,您可以在构建完成之前对其进行调试。

构建报告

禁用自动构建

自动构建是按分支或标签启用的,可以禁用和重新启用。当您只想在一段时间内手动构建时(例如在对代码进行重大重构时),可能会这样做。禁用自动构建不会禁用自动测试

要禁用自动构建:

  1. Docker Hub 中,转到我的 Hub > 仓库,选择一个仓库,然后选择构建选项卡。

  2. 选择配置自动构建以编辑仓库的构建设置。

  3. 构建规则部分,找到您不再希望自动构建的分支或标签。

  4. 选择配置行旁边的自动构建切换开关。禁用时,切换开关呈灰色。

  5. 选择保存